China is an important sourcing base for boat parts because it combines large-scale machining capacity, coastal export infrastructure, mature metalworking supply chains, and experience serving both marine aftermarket and vessel-building projects. In 2025, China accounted for 56.1% of global shipbuilding output and 69% of global new shipbuilding orders, underlining the depth of its marine manufacturing ecosystem.
For buyers of outboard gears, crankshafts, drive shafts, propeller shafts, marine gearboxes, propellers, and related replacement parts, the key issue is not simply obtaining a low quotation. The priority is finding a supplier that can repeatedly deliver the approved material grade, heat-treatment route, dimensional accuracy, corrosion protection, and packaging standard.
This guide identifies ten China-based manufacturers and specialist suppliers with different strengths. Some are most suitable for outboard aftermarket programs, while others support commercial-vessel propulsion systems, marine gearboxes, propellers, or marine hardware.

For gears and shafts, buyers should also ask how the supplier defines allowable material variation, hardness range, case depth where applicable, tooth-contact requirements, runout, and fatigue-life targets. ISO 6336 provides widely used principles for gear load-capacity calculations, while ISO 6336-5 specifically addresses material quality and heat-treatment effects on gear strength.
China's marine supply chain is not concentrated in one city. Different regions serve different product categories:
- Ningbo and Zhejiang: Precision machining, outboard replacement parts, marine gearboxes, shafts, export logistics, and ship-supporting components.
- Hangzhou: Marine gearboxes, industrial transmission systems, propulsion-related equipment, and technical drive solutions.
- Zhoushan: Shipbuilding, propellers, shaft lines, rudder systems, repair services, and vessel-related equipment.
- Qingdao and Shandong: Outboard propellers, stainless steel and aluminum marine accessories, fishing-boat equipment, and export-oriented marine hardware.
- Jiangsu: Marine hardware, boat seating, deck fittings, propellers, casting, and vessel-supporting manufacturing.
Industrial clusters can shorten sourcing cycles because specialized factories, material suppliers, machining partners, inspection services, ports, and logistics providers are located within the same regional network.

A supplier may make the first sample using better steel, additional manual finishing, or tighter process control, then change the material source or heat-treatment route during volume production.
How to reduce risk: Freeze the approved material grade, heat-treatment route, hardness range, first-article report, and packaging method in the purchase agreement.
A certificate may belong to a parent company, a sales company, an old factory address, or a subcontractor rather than the legal entity producing the parts.
How to reduce risk: Match the legal company name, factory address, certificate number, certification scope, issuing body, and expiration date. IAF CertSearch enables buyers to check whether a management-system certificate is valid and whether the certification body is accredited.
"Stainless steel" is not a complete specification. Different grades behave very differently in saltwater environments.
How to reduce risk: Specify grade, finish, passivation requirement where applicable, salt-spray target, and third-party material-verification method.
For gears and shafts, machining dimensions can look correct while the part still fails early because the hardness profile, case depth, tempering, or distortion control is inadequate.
How to reduce risk: Ask whether heat treatment is done internally or externally, require batch-level hardness records, and retain the right to conduct random independent material and hardness testing.
Precision shafts, gears, and propellers can rust, scratch, or deform during ocean freight if packaging is treated as an afterthought.
How to reduce risk: Require VCI protection or rust inhibitor, individual surface protection for critical contact areas, moisture barrier bags where needed, reinforced cartons or wooden cases, and clear carton-level traceability.
A highly effective but rarely discussed control is to approve the process route, not just the finished sample.
For example, two propeller shafts may have the same drawing dimensions and similar surface appearance, but one may use approved steel, controlled rough machining, proper stress relief, finish machining, spline inspection, and corrosion protection. The other may rely on less stable material, uncontrolled subcontracting, and inconsistent finishing.
Before the first production order, ask the supplier to provide a one-page process flow showing:
1. Raw-material supplier and material certificate.
2. Rough-machining route.
3. Heat-treatment route.
4. Finish-machining and grinding steps.
5. Critical inspection points.
6. Final packaging method.
7. Outsourced processes, if any.
A factory that can explain this clearly is generally easier to manage over repeat orders than one that only provides catalogue photos and a low quotation.

Check the certificate number, legal entity name, factory address, certification body, scope, issue date, and expiry date. Then verify it through IAF CertSearch or directly with the issuing certification body. A valid certificate should match the actual manufacturing entity and certified site.
Ask which critical processes are performed internally, request an equipment list, review the production flow, and ask for real inspection records. A genuine manufacturer should be able to explain where gear cutting, CNC machining, grinding, heat treatment, balancing, and final inspection occur.
At minimum, verify material composition, hardness, straightness, runout, spline geometry, bearing-seat diameter, seal-surface finish, corrosion protection, and fitment on the intended lower unit. For high-load applications, consider torsional-load and fatigue testing.
No. CE marking is required only for products within the scope of applicable European Union legislation. Recreational craft, certain components, and propulsion engines can be subject to specific requirements, but a loose mechanical spare part is not automatically required to carry CE marking. Confirm the obligations for the exact product and market before shipment.
Dimensional compliance does not prove fatigue resistance or wear performance. Incorrect hardness, inadequate case depth, poor tempering, or uncontrolled distortion can cause gears and shafts to fail under load even when they initially fit the assembly.
